Amendments to Material Control and Accounting Regulations
Document Number: 2019-14478
Type: Proposed Rule
Date: 2019-07-08
Agency: Nuclear Regulatory Commission, Agencies and Commissions
The U.S. Nuclear Regulatory Commission (NRC) is discontinuing a rulemaking activity that would have consolidated and revised the material control and accounting requirements for special nuclear material. The purpose of this action is to inform members of the public of the discontinuation of the rulemaking activity and to provide a brief discussion of the NRC's decision. The rulemaking activity will no longer be reported in the NRC's portion of the Unified Agenda of Regulatory and Deregulatory Actions (the Unified Agenda).
Expiration Term for Certificates of Compliance for Transportation Packages
Document Number: 2019-14463
Type: Notice
Date: 2019-07-08
Agency: Nuclear Regulatory Commission, Agencies and Commissions
The U.S. Nuclear Regulatory Commission (NRC) is noticing the availability of the ``Basis Document for Expiration Term for Certificates of Compliance for Transportation Packages'' (Basis Document). The Basis Document details the NRC's analysis and development of a programmatic basis for the 5-year expiration term for certificates of compliance for transportation packages.

Qualification and Training of Personnel for Nuclear Power Plants
Document Number: 2019-14441
Type: Notice
Date: 2019-07-08
Agency: Nuclear Regulatory Commission, Agencies and Commissions
The U.S. Nuclear Regulatory Commission (NRC) is issuing Revision 4 to Regulatory Guide (RG) 1.8, ``Qualification and Training of Personnel for Nuclear Power Plants.'' This RG describes methods acceptable to the NRC staff for complying with those portions of the Commission's regulations associated with the selection, qualifications, and training for nuclear power plant personnel. Revision 4 updates the RG with additional experience gained since Revision 3 was issued in 2000 by endorsing American National Standards Institute/American Nuclear Society (ANSI/ANS)-3.1-2014, ``Selection, Qualification, and Training of Personnel for Nuclear Power Plants,'' with exceptions and clarifications.

Portland General Electric Company; Trojan Independent Spent Fuel Storage Installation
Document Number: 2019-14397
Type: Notice
Date: 2019-07-08
Agency: Nuclear Regulatory Commission, Agencies and Commissions
The U.S. Nuclear Regulatory Commission (NRC) is considering the renewal of Special Nuclear Materials (SNM) License SNM-2509 for the Trojan Nuclear Plant Independent Spent Fuel Storage Installation (ISFSI) (Trojan ISFSI) located in Columbia County, Oregon. The NRC has prepared an environmental assessment (EA) for this proposed license renewal in accordance with its regulations. Based on the EA, the NRC has concluded that a finding of no significant impact (FONSI) is appropriate. The NRC also is conducting a safety evaluation of the proposed license renewal.
